How to define a r-curve in the raglan shape type, in the armhole narrowing at the body:

    • The dimensioned shape is opened in the Dimensioning View FormularShapeView.
    • The startpoint and endpoint of the Narrowing of Armhole are dimensioned horizontally and vertically.

  1. Open the context menu for the left diagonal shape line of the armhole narrowing at the rear.
    ScreenHunter_265 Apr. 07 21.34
  2. Select the ShapeLinePropertiesLine Properties.
    • The Line Properties tool window appears.
  3. Activate CheckBoxOnShow Line View.
    • The selected shape line appears in the line view.

  4. Go to the Stepping Parameters group box.
  5. Select the List Box Whiter-curve option in the Stepping KindLittleRCurveLineAttrib list box.
    • The line view updates.

  6. Keep the value 0 in the Min. Step HeightTextBox+Spin_1 edit box.
  7. Select the value 2 in the Step WidthTextBox+Spin_1 edit box
  8. Keep the undefined option in the Stepping in the HeightList Box White list box.
  9. Select the value 2 in the Min. Height at the End of LineTextBox+Spin_1 edit box.
    • The line view updates.

  10. Activate the CheckBoxOnBinding-off at Line Foot check box.
    • The Line Width by StitchesTextBox+Spin_10 edit box appears enabled.
  11. Select the value 6 in the Line Width by StitchesTextBox+Spin_10 edit box.
    • The line view updates.

    • The Binding-off entry appears in the Function column of the line S. 1.
    • The steppings in the narrowing of armhole form an r-curve.

    • Module, width and look of the narrowing from the default settings are assigned in the sub-rows with the Narrowing function.
